Germany
New Year's Day
Local Name: Neujahr
Tuesday
January 1, 2030
Epiphany
Local Name: Heilige Drei Könige
Sunday
January 6, 2030
International Women's Day
Local Name: Internationaler Frauentag
Friday
March 8, 2030
Good Friday
Local Name: Karfreitag
Friday
April 19, 2030
Easter Sunday
Local Name: Ostersonntag
Sunday
April 21, 2030
Easter Monday
Local Name: Ostermontag
Monday
April 22, 2030
Labour Day
Local Name: Tag der Arbeit
Wednesday
May 1, 2030
Ascension Day
Local Name: Christi Himmelfahrt
Thursday
May 30, 2030
Pentecost
Local Name: Pfingstsonntag
Sunday
June 9, 2030
Whit Monday
Local Name: Pfingstmontag
Monday
June 10, 2030
Corpus Christi
Local Name: Fronleichnam
Thursday
June 20, 2030
Assumption Day
Local Name: Mariä Himmelfahrt
Thursday
August 15, 2030
World Children's Day
Local Name: Weltkindertag
Friday
September 20, 2030
German Unity Day
Local Name: Tag der Deutschen Einheit
Thursday
October 3, 2030
Reformation Day
Local Name: Reformationstag
Thursday
October 31, 2030
All Saints' Day
Local Name: Allerheiligen
Friday
November 1, 2030
Repentance and Prayer Day
Local Name: Buß- und Bettag
Wednesday
November 20, 2030
Christmas Day
Local Name: Erster Weihnachtstag
Wednesday
December 25, 2030
St. Stephen's Day
Local Name: Zweiter Weihnachtstag
Thursday
December 26, 2030